Sinopsis

Rocks and Ridges: 15 Classic Books in Geology is a remarkable anthology that captures the evolution and depth of geological literature. This collection spans a broad range of literary styles, from the meticulous scientific observations found in early geological treatises to more narrative-driven explorations of Earth's physical history. The anthology compiles diverse works that have significantly shaped understanding of geological phenomena, such as the formation of the Earth's crust and the processes governing rock formation. With its inclusion of seminal essays and comprehensive geological surveys, it serves as both an intellectual journey through time and a captivating exploration of Earth's dynamic landscapes. The contributors to this collection, including esteemed figures like William Harmon Norton and Charles Sir Lyell, represent the pinnacles of geological scholarship. This assembly of authors transcends time, stretching from Sir John William Dawson's pioneering 19th-century research to Frederic Brewster Loomis's 20th-century insights. Together, these authors weave a rich tapestry of geological inquiry, reflecting the scientific zeitgeist of their respective eras. The anthology mirrors the progression of geological thought and aligns with the cultural shifts and scientific advancements that accompanied the Industrial Revolution and subsequent technological progress. Rocks and Ridges offers an unparalleled glimpse into the minds shaping geological science, making it an essential read. It provides an extraordinary opportunity for both students and enthusiasts of geology to immerse themselves in the multifaceted discourse of Earth's physical history. The collection’s wealth of insights and perspectives not only educates but also inspires dialogue about the complex processes that govern our planet. This anthology stands as a compelling testament to the enduring fascination and significance of geology in understanding our world's natural wonders.

    Did Alaska create the music of John Luther Adams, or did the music create his Alaska? For the past thirty years, the vastness of Alaska has swept through the distant reaches of the composer's imagination and every corner of his compositions. In this new book Adams proposes an ideal of musical ecology, the philosophical foundation on which his largest, most complex musical work is based. This installation, also called The Place Where You Go to Listen, is a sound and light environment that gives voice to the cycles of sunlight and darkness, the phases of the moon, the seismic rhythms of the earth, and the dance of the aurora borealis. Adams describes this work as "a place for hearing the unheard music of the world around us." The book includes two seminal essays, the composer's journal telling the story of the day-to-day emergence of The Place, as well as musical notations, graphs and illustrations of geophysical phenomena.
